It was a special friend’s birthday the other day & I wanted to create something special for her in the way of a gift pack. She is such a fun loving crazy gal, so there was no question, it had to be bright & fun!

I am trying to be more ‘green’ about my scrapping these days & having a huge box of PP off cuts, I decided to use some of them up rather than just binning them. For the card, I cut myself a variety of  mini box shapes & layered them in a pile on the base card using different thicknesses of 3D puff tape. Then  tied some of them with ribbons & braid adding glitter for birthday sparkle. I suggest you use a fast drying glue like ‘mono’, sprinkle a layer of glitter lightly over the glued areas & wait for them to dry. Tap off any loose glitter….& Voila!! pretty finishes in a flash!

I left a little teeny white tag on the front of the pink parcel for me to write my buddy’s name :o)
